Can someone explain
キレーなフォームで
キレーな回転を
投げたがんのは
日本人の気質も
あんのかと思う
I understand most of this, but if you could please explain the third and last lines, it would be greatly appreciated!
6 aug. 2014 15:36
Antwoorden · 3
1
As for the third line, probably the part you don't understand is がん, and this is same meaning as がる, which means "want to" "wish to" generally used as 〜したがる
And for the last line,あんのかとis same as あるのかと
I'm not sure who's saying this, but this way of talking sounds so casual, especially because of ん sound instead of る
It sounds like a young guy talking.
